What is the initial cost of owning a Del Taco?

The initial franchise fee is $35,000. The total estimated initial investment range is $812,700-$2,368,000 and includes the initial franchise fees, training costs, inventory, build-out expenses, computer hardware and software, insurance and three months working capital.

How much does it cost to start a Taco Bell?

$1,500,000: Your minimum net worth in order to open a franchise. $45,000: The fee you must pay to Taco Bell to own a franchise. $1,200,000: The average start up and construction costs to build a new Taco Bell. Could be as high as $2.5 million.

How much does it cost to own a Chick Fil A?

Opening a Chick-fil-A franchise costs between $342,990 and $1,982,225, including a $10,000 franchise fee, but unlike most other franchisors, Chick-fil-A covers all opening expenses, meaning franchisees are on the hook only for that $10,000.

How much does it cost to own a McDonald's?

McDonald's franchisee applicants must have a minimum of $500,000 available in liquid assets and pay a $45,000 franchise fee. Those looking to launch a new McDonald's franchise can expect to shell out between $1,314,500 and $2,306,500. Existing franchise prices can cost upwards of $1 million or more.

What does the initial franchise fee cover?

Under the FTC Franchise Rule, the initial franchise fee is for goods and services received from the franchisor before the franchisee's business opens. This fee covers intellectual property licenses including trademark and service marks.

How much does it cost to own a franchise of Subway?

Subway is one of the cheapest major fast-food restaurants to franchise. Subway's fee for becoming a franchisee is $15,000, and startup costs, which include construction and equipment leasing expenses, range from $116,000 to $263,000, according to the company.

How much did Del Taco sell for?

Del Taco is officially part of the Jack in the Box Inc. family. San Diego-based Jack in the Box Inc. said Tuesday it has completed the previously announced deal to acquire Del Taco Restaurants Inc. for about $585 million, a move that has brought like-minded quick-service brands together to accelerate growth.

Is Del Taco only on the West Coast?

The majority of their restaurants are in California. Del Taco also operates in other western states (including Arizona, Colorado, Idaho, Montana, Nevada, New Mexico, Oklahoma, Oregon, Texas, Washington, and Utah), and has a handful of locations sprinkled around areas east of the Mississippi.

How much does it cost to franchise a KFC?

For non-traditional KFC outlets, KFC charges an initial license fee of $10,000 for a five-year term, and $15,000 for a 10-year term. For traditional KFC franchise agreements, the franchise (or initial license) fee is $45,000 split into the deposit fee and the option fee.

How much does a Sonic franchise cost?

The license fee for a traditional SONIC restaurant is $45,000, with a total investment ranging from $1,242,200 to $3,537,700 (excluding land). The license fee for a non-traditional SONIC restaurant is $22,500, with a total investment ranging from $361,900 to $978,700 (excluding land).

How much does it cost to open a Wingstop franchise?

Franchise fee: The Wingstop franchise fee is $20,000 per store. There is also a development fee of $10,000 per store. Keep in mind, you're required to open at least three stores. Net worth: Wingstop requires a minimum net worth of $1.2 million.
